    Several years ago I opted to go predator calling at night during a Super Moon. I arrived at my hunting spot at sunset. Decided to take a quick hike down into a drainage to see if there was water. There was a small pond and very fresh lion tracks around it. I had hiked down from the vehicle unarmed. I felt a little vulnerable as I jogged at dusk the couple hundred yards back to the truck to set up. Got to the back end of the truck and as I reached for the back door, I glanced at myself in the tow mirrors for a second but saw movement behind me. I turned around in time to see a lion peel off from the trail we'd both been on. I was on the left side of the truck, it ran at a 45' to the right of the Ford and disappeared into the brush. The cat had followed me from the water down below and was probably sizing me up as prey as we went up the trail. My last encounter with a lion was just north of Reavis Ranch. My dog is normally about 50 yards or less ahead of me while trail riding. Just as we headed along the canyon side before the turret, my dog suddenly ran back to me in a panic. I looked up in time to see a lion a hundred yards ahead of me jump down from a boulder above the trail and then race down into the canyon. I think if my dog had been fifty yards farther down the trail that cat would have taken my dog with him.

    Sometime back I read a book documenting mountain lion attacks on humans. One fellow was a young, athletic and experienced backwoodsman employed by a lumber company for surveying and assessing timber stands. He played college football; a running back, and knew what it was like being blindsided and hit hard. He said that lions initial tackle was far more powerful than any hit he'd ever received on the gridiron. Knocked the wind out of him and the Lion wasn't letting go. Credited his backpack with saving his life.
